The Science Behind Clear Skin
Clear skin isn’t just about luck or expensive creams—it’s a reflection of your body’s internal health and external care. Your skin is the largest organ and serves as a protective barrier against environmental aggressors, bacteria, and pollutants. When this barrier is compromised or overwhelmed by excess oil, dirt, or dead skin cells, it can lead to clogged pores, acne, dullness, and uneven texture.
The key to achieving radiant skin lies in maintaining the skin’s natural balance. This includes regulating oil production, supporting cell turnover, and keeping inflammation in check. Factors such as genetics, hormones, lifestyle habits, and diet all play significant roles in how your skin looks and feels.
Understanding these elements helps you approach skincare with a holistic mindset rather than quick fixes. By focusing on natural methods that support your body’s processes, you can achieve clear skin naturally fast without harsh chemicals or invasive treatments.
Hydration: The Foundation of Clear Skin
Water is essential for every function in your body—including your skin’s health. Proper hydration keeps your skin plump, elastic, and able to repair itself efficiently. When dehydrated, skin can become dry, flaky, and more prone to irritation or breakouts.
Drinking enough water flushes toxins from your system and supports circulation. Aim for at least 8 glasses (about 2 liters) daily. You can also hydrate through water-rich foods like cucumbers, watermelon, oranges, and leafy greens.
Topical hydration matters too. Using a lightweight moisturizer suited to your skin type helps lock in moisture without clogging pores. Look for natural ingredients such as aloe vera, hyaluronic acid (naturally derived), or jojoba oil that mimic the skin’s own oils.

Balanced Diet: Fuel Your Skin From Within
Your diet directly influences how your skin looks. Nutrient-dense foods provide antioxidants that neutralize free radicals—unstable molecules that damage cells and accelerate aging. Vitamins A, C, E, zinc, and omega-3 fatty acids are particularly crucial for healthy skin.
Cutting back on processed sugars and refined carbs reduces inflammation—a major contributor to acne breakouts and redness. Instead, focus on whole foods rich in fiber like fruits, vegetables, nuts, seeds, lean proteins (such as fish or poultry), and healthy fats like avocado or olive oil.
Certain foods promote collagen production—the protein responsible for skin strength and elasticity:
- Vitamin C-rich foods: Oranges, strawberries, bell peppers
- Zinc sources: Pumpkin seeds, chickpeas
- Omega-3 fatty acids: Salmon, flaxseeds

The Power of Gentle Cleansing Routines
Cleansing your face properly sets the stage for clear skin naturally fast by removing dirt without stripping essential oils. Over-washing or using harsh soaps can disrupt the pH balance of the skin and increase dryness or irritation.
Choose gentle cleansers free from sulfates and artificial fragrances. Ingredients like honey (natural antibacterial), oatmeal (soothing), or green tea extracts work wonders without causing harm.
A twice-daily routine—morning and night—is usually sufficient unless you’ve been sweating heavily or exposed to pollution. Use lukewarm water since hot water depletes moisture quickly while cold water may not remove grime effectively.
Pat dry gently with a soft towel instead of rubbing aggressively to prevent micro-tears in the delicate facial skin.
Cleansing Steps for Best Results:
- Dampen face with lukewarm water.
- Squeeze a small amount of cleanser onto fingertips.
- Massage gently in circular motions across face.
- Rinse thoroughly with lukewarm water.
- Pat dry with a clean towel.
- Apply moisturizer immediately after while skin is still slightly damp.
The Role of Sun Protection in Clear Skin Maintenance
Sun exposure accelerates aging by breaking down collagen fibers leading to wrinkles and pigmentation issues such as dark spots or redness. UV rays also increase inflammation which worsens acne-prone conditions.
Applying sunscreen daily—even when indoors near windows—is vital for preserving clear complexion naturally fast. Choose broad-spectrum sunscreens that protect against both UVA (aging rays) and UVB (burning rays).
Look for physical blockers containing zinc oxide or titanium dioxide which are less likely to irritate sensitive skin compared to chemical filters.
Reapply every two hours if outdoors for prolonged periods; wear hats or seek shade when possible during peak sun hours between 10 am–4 pm.
Sunscreen Tips:
- Select SPF 30+ formulas suitable for your skin type.
- Avoid products heavy on alcohols that dry out the skin.
- If prone to breakouts choose non-comedogenic sunscreens labeled “oil-free.”
- If makeup is part of your routine use powders or sprays containing SPF for touch-ups during the day.
Lifestyle Habits That Boost Natural Skin Clarity
Beyond topical care and diet lies an array of lifestyle factors that influence how quickly you see improvements in your complexion:
Sleep:
Sleep allows the body—and especially the skin—to repair itself overnight by producing new cells while flushing out toxins accumulated during waking hours. Aim for 7-9 hours per night; poor sleep increases cortisol levels which trigger inflammation leading to breakouts.
Avoid Touching Your Face:
Hands carry dirt and bacteria that clog pores when transferred repeatedly onto facial areas causing pimples or irritation especially around the nose and chin regions.
Avoid Smoking & Limit Alcohol:
Smoking restricts blood flow reducing oxygen delivery needed by cells while alcohol dehydrates making fine lines more visible plus causing redness due to dilated blood vessels.
Mild Exercise:
Exercise boosts circulation promoting oxygen-rich blood flow which helps nourish cells while sweating helps unclog pores naturally removing impurities from deep within follicles.

Natural Ingredients That Speed Up Skin Renewal
Certain natural ingredients accelerate exfoliation—the process where dead cells shed revealing fresh glowing layers underneath—and soothe irritated inflamed areas boosting clarity fast:
- Aloe Vera: Contains vitamins A,C,E plus anti-inflammatory compounds reducing redness while hydrating deeply without greasiness.
- Green Tea Extract: Rich in antioxidants polyphenols neutralizing free radicals preventing premature aging plus antibacterial benefits reducing acne-causing bacteria growth.
- Honey: Natural humectant locking moisture into layers plus mild antiseptic properties helping clear minor blemishes gently without dryness associated with chemical treatments.
- Lemon Juice (in moderation): The citric acid acts as a natural exfoliant brightening dull patches but must be diluted properly due to potential irritation risk especially on sensitive skins.
- Coconut Oil: An emollient sealing moisture but best used sparingly on dry areas only since it may clog pores if used excessively on oily complexions.

The Role Of Consistency In How To Get Clear Skin Naturally Fast?
No matter how effective individual steps are they require commitment over weeks—not days—to show lasting results.
Skin cell turnover takes about 28 days so changes become visible gradually.
Building simple daily habits such as drinking enough water cleansing gently applying sunscreen eating nutrient-packed meals sleeping well reduces flare-ups improves texture brightness steadily.
Avoid switching products frequently which can cause irritation preventing progress.
Patience combined with persistence ensures you get clear radiant glowing results naturally fast without harsh interventions.
